Qualifications & Requirements
- Active Nurse Practitioner (NP) or Physician Assistant (PA-C) license.
- Current DEA registration.
- American Heart Association (AHA) Basic Life Support (BLS) and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certifications.
- For Physician Assistants (PA-C): Willingness to obtain state licensure (processing time approximately 6 weeks).
- Experience in pediatric cardiac critical care and proficiency in relevant procedures strongly preferred.
